European football’s biggest night has finally arrived, with French champions Paris Saint-Germain facing Premier League winners Arsenal in the UEFA Champions League final.

Both clubs enter the match in exceptional form, but the key question remains: who is more likely to lift the trophy?

Based on recent form, squad depth, experience, statistical models and tactical matchups, PSG appear to hold a slight advantage heading into the final.

Multiple football analysts and prediction models have placed the defending champions as favourites, with Opta’s supercomputer giving PSG a 56% chance of victory compared to Arsenal’s 44%.

The biggest factor working in PSG’s favour is experience. Luis Enrique’s side are the reigning European champions and have reached more Champions League finals than any other club since 2020.

They have already navigated a brutal route to Budapest, eliminating some of Europe’s strongest teams, including Chelsea, Liverpool and Bayern Munich.

PSG also boast one of the most dangerous attacking units in Europe. Georgian star Khvicha Kvaratskhelia has been directly involved in 10 goals during the knockout rounds and arrives in Budapest as arguably the tournament’s most influential attacker.

However, writing off Arsenal would be a mistake.

Mikel Arteta’s side have developed into one of the continent’s most disciplined teams. The Gunners possess the best defensive record in this season’s Champions League campaign, conceding only six goals in 14 matches.

Their organisation, midfield control and threat from set pieces could prove decisive against PSG.

Arsenal also arrive with renewed confidence after ending a 22-year wait for the Premier League title. Arteta has repeatedly said the domestic triumph has only increased the squad’s hunger to make history by winning the club’s first-ever Champions League crown.

Tactically, the final appears to be a clash between Europe’s most potent attack and its strongest defence. Analysts believe Arsenal must remain compact and disciplined because attempting to match PSG in an open attacking contest could play directly into the French side’s strengths.

Another factor is freshness. PSG have enjoyed a slightly longer break before the final, while Arsenal have played additional domestic fixtures in recent weeks. Several analysts believe that advantage could become important if the match extends into extra time.

Prediction

If Arsenal can keep the game tight, dominate set pieces and limit PSG’s transitions, they have every chance of causing an upset.

But based on current form, experience, attacking firepower and statistical projections, PSG enter the final as slight favourites.

Predicted Result: PSG 2-1 Arsenal

Probability:

  • PSG win: 55%
  • Arsenal win: 45%

Expect a close, tactical contest that could be decided by one moment of brilliance from either side, but PSG’s experience on this stage may ultimately prove the difference.
